As a young girl Molly Wright found comfort in drawing and painting. While art wasn't initially considered a career option, Molly had a wonderful high school art department experience that inspired her to continue to create art even if only on the side. After a stint in the catering business and raising her children, Molly rediscovered her love for painting and began selling her work for the first time after opening up her home for her first show. What started as a side hobby eventually turned into a full-fledged career, driven by Molly's decision to prioritize her art. You’ll have to tune in to hear Molly’s reflections on the unexpected strengths she uncovered along her journey as an art business owner. Today you’ll find Molly working on her next collection release focused on landscapes and of course coastal pieces that reflect her beautiful home surroundings. Molly’s gratitude for her life and her art is so evident in our conversation. It was lovely getting to listen to her share the wisdom she’s gained over the fifteen years of her art business.
